Bhitar Amda - Dumaria, East Singhbum

Bhitar Amda is a village situated in the Dumaria subdivision of East Singhbum district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 18 km from Dumaria and around 70 km from Purbi Singhbhum. Khairbani ser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bhitar Amda village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Bhitar Amda is 364044. The village covers a total geographical area of 858.25 hectares and falls under the 832104 pincode. Jamshedpur is the nearest town.

Bhitar Amda village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Bhitar Amda

As per Census 2011, Bhitar Amda village has a total population of 702 people, consisting of 332 males and 370 females. The village has 133 households and a sex ratio of 1,114 females per 1,000 males. There are 123 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 255 literate and 447 illiterate residents. Additionally, 606 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Bhitar Amda

Bhitar Amda is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is Kuldiha, while the nearest airport is Sonari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 37.1 km.
